India’s Dewan Housing Finance Corp has hit the loan market for a $100m borrowing, three months after holding a non-deal roadshow in Taipei.

Hong Kong-listed Samsonite is raising a loan of up to $2.425bn for its acquisition of premium travel luggage maker Tumi.

Moody’s has cut Standard Chartered’s credit rating by one notch to A1 from Aa3 following a four-month review, basing its decision on a deterioration in asset quality and profitability at the lender.

Singapore real estate firm Ascendas ventured into the country’s domestic bond market on Monday with a S$100m ($72.8m) offering that was largely driven by reverse enquiry.
